Specifies an aspect value for an element that will preserve the x-height of the first-choice font. If the aspect value is high, the font will be legible when it is set to a smaller size.
Example
| h2 {font-size-adjust: 0.58} |
Possible Values
| Value | Description |
|---|---|
| none | Do not preserve the font’s x-height if the font is unavailable |
| number | Defines the aspect value ratio for the font The formula to use: Example: If 14px Verdana (aspect value of 0.58) was unavailable, but an available font had an aspect value of 0.46, the font-size of the substitute would be 14 * (0.58/0.46) = 17.65px |
